AS Roma striker Pablo Osvaldo scored a sensational goal that will be one of the main contenders for goal of the season.

Czech coach Zdeněk Zeman, famous for his all-attack style of football, is back at the Stadio Olimpico after 13 years and he named an attacking line-up for the visit of Catania on Sunday.

But the Giallorossi was made to pay for their lack of defensive discipline just 29 minutes in, as Giovanni Marchese slammed home a loose ball from a Sergio Almirón free-kick.

The home side drew level on the hour mark and they did it with real style.

Daniele De Rossi lofted a superb ball over the Catania defense for Osvaldo to leap into the air and convert it with a stunning scissor-kick.

The ball went into the far side of the goal, well past the outstretched arms of Catania goalkeeper Mariano Andújar.

Alejandro Gómez restored Catania's lead in the 68th minute but 18-year-old Nico López leveled in stoppage time on his debut only moments after coming off the bench.
